We're waiting to show off your Ruby creativity.

programming
Write one function that is useful for you and others

How many times you have been looking for a function that does one thing and you end up using a gem just for one function?
Here we'll fix that, consider rubyfunctions.com is your repository for useful functions, you can get back to it any time

bibliophile
Depend on Ruby standard library and core library only

We all have seen the problem with too many dependencies, here we'll try to be as minimal as we can, we'll build off of ruby core and standard library only, making our functions as independent as possible, this means you'll be able to use it any project regardless of its framework

public discussion
Show it to others and get feedback

Now that you have a useful repository of functions you have wrote, show it to other developers, your function maybe useful for other people, Also you will get feedback from other developers to improve your knowledge, And you'll have the chance to also give feedback to others and learn something new from their functions

Ali Hamdi Ali Fadel · @Ali Hamdi Ali Fadel

Github

Ahmed Khaled · @Ahmed Khaled

Github

Ahmed Magdy · @Ahmed Magdy

Github

Abd Elrahman Telb · @Abd Elrahman Telb

Github

Emad Elsaid · @Emad Elsaid

Github

taman9333 · @taman9333

Github

ahmadabdelhalim · @ahmadabdelhalim

Github

Denny Vrandečić · @Denny Vrandečić

Github

Taghreed Mohammed Kamel · @Taghreed Mohammed Kamel

Github

Ahmed Kamal · @Ahmed Kamal

Github

Ehab Ahmed · @Ehab Ahmed

Github

Rudy Zidan · @Rudy Zidan

Github

Ahmad Alfy · @Ahmad Alfy

Github

Mahmoud Mu · @Mahmoud Mu

Github

Ahmed Ashraf · @Ahmed Ashraf

Github

2codeThemes · @2codeThemes

Github

Mahmoud Slah · @Mahmoud Slah

Github

Mahmoud Hossam · @Mahmoud Hossam

Github

Mohamed Gaber · @Mohamed Gaber

Github

Mohammed ragab ali · @Mohammed ragab ali

Github

TalaatMagdy · @TalaatMagdy

Github

Osama · @Osama

Github

Amr El-Bakry · @Amr El-Bakry

Github

ahmed · @ahmed

Github

Nagy Salem · @Nagy Salem

Github

ahmadwinchester · @ahmadwinchester

Github

Ahmad Ra'fat · @Ahmad Ra'fat

Github

IbrahimMohamed · @IbrahimMohamed

Github

Ibrahim Sabry · @Ibrahim Sabry

Github

AbdelRahman Wahdan · @AbdelRahman Wahdan

Github

Your next adventures
project completed Lets start our journey in ruby functions. The following steps should help your get started.
  • Login with your Github account
  • Publish your first function
  • Like at least 5 functions
  • Write at least 5 comments
  • Save at least 5 functions
  • Publish 10 functions